At least 100 innocent lives were tragically lost on Wednesday when the Sudanese paramilitary Rapid Support Forces launched a brutal attack on a village in Gezira State, according to local activists. This devastating news has sent shockwaves throughout the country and has once again brought attention to the ongoing violence and conflict in Sudan.
The attack, which took place in the village of Al-Salam, was reportedly carried out by the Rapid Support Forces (RSF) in retaliation for an earlier clash between the RSF and local farmers over land rights. Witnesses described a scene of chaos and destruction as the RSF stormed the village, firing indiscriminately and setting homes on fire. The death toll is expected to rise as many are still missing and injured.
The RSF, a paramilitary group formed from the Janjaweed militia, has been accused of numerous human rights violations in the past, including the massacre of civilians in Darfur. Despite promises of reform and integration into the Sudanese military, the RSF continues to operate with impunity and has been a major source of instability and violence in the country.
The attack on Al-Salam village is just the latest in a series of violent incidents that have plagued Sudan in recent years. The country has been in a state of turmoil since the ousting of former President Omar al-Bashir in 2019, with various armed groups vying for power and control. The ongoing conflict has resulted in the displacement of millions of people and has left countless others dead or injured.
